Hey!

At the moment I'm at a LAN in my school over the holiday. It's just a small LAN with around 50 people, anyway: They had a one vs one tournament in Dawn of War, which I had never played before. I thought why not participate? I got the game from a dude and got through the tutorial, and then played a few games vs some at the LAN. I won the most of my matches. Then the tournament started and I won every single one of my games. In the end I won the tournament, with the final match being a bo3 with commentator and the game showed on big screen.

And this was the day after I even started playing the game. I defeated people who had played the game for over a year. I noticed they didn't use hotkeys or sometimes not even the keyboard at all.

Starcraft skillz > all

Haha i've been doing this same thing on every single RTS game that has come out in years and I'm only D+/C- at Starcraft

I've got this trademark thing (among friends / at LANs) of making a "3 day promise" - you pick an RTS game and even though I've never played it I will beat you at it in 3 days guaranteed. Worked for cocky assholes at Age of Empires III, Company of Heroes, Dawn of War, Empire Earth, etc.

It even works on Warcraft III (though this one is by far the closest to SC in terms of depth and much more difficult to use) I gave my friend who had been playing the game for YEARS and had thousands of 1v1 wins a "1 month promise" to see if i could beat him by the end of the month. When the time came I won 2-1 in a Bo3 and then proceeded to beat him again 7-0 a month later.

SC is seriously the most skill intensive game basically ever made. Only some hardcore fighting games are of similiar depth.
